Dan Gregory is the Co-Founder of strategic think-tank, The Impossible Institute™, who describes himself as being in the business of making smart people... people smart! He works as a speaker, author, consultant and social commentator and his passion is human behaviour and the elements of influence - what inspires and engages our people, our customers, our communities and ourselves.

Dan has worked as a stand up comedian, developed new product lines for Coca-Cola and Unilever, been a regular on ABC TV's "Gruen" series and launched engagement campaigns for companies as varied as Vodafone, MTV and the United Nations. He is also the co-author, along with Kieran Flanagan, of Selfish, Scared and Stupid: Stop Fighting Human Nature And Increase Your Performance, Engagement And Influence.

In this interview Dan discusses his thoughts on human behaviour, advertising, leadership, sales, the future of the workplace and the skills required to be successful.
